Not every case carries the same risk. A single zirconia molar crown for a doctor with 200 prior cases and no remakes is low risk. A full-arch hybrid PMMA for a new doctor is another story.
The engine learns from YOUR lab — not industry averages. It recalibrates every week with your own production data.
